Comments (2)
I should specify that my confusion arises from the decorator for a test phase requiring a configured plug, meaning my plug needs to be configured prior to the decorator. Ideally I would like my test definitions to be separate from the configuration of the plugs required for them, as they will vary from station to station that the tests are being run on.
from openhtf.
OK! Figured it out. bind_init_args will only bind the key to the plug's initialization arguments. Since CONF is a singleton instance, if you load another value to the declared key, it will use that new value when the phase runs with the configured plug. Closing. Hopefully this helps someone out in the future
from openhtf.
Related Issues (20)
- Support tornado>=6.0 HOT 3
- There is a plain text password in the github actions HOT 2
- Incorrect SerializedTestRecord type annotation
- is this project dead ? HOT 10
- Request: visualize FAIL_AND_CONTINUE as red color on the web frontend. HOT 2
- AttributeError: '_Configuration' object has no attribute 'KeyAlreadyDeclaredError' HOT 4
- Request: add stop bottom in web gui and signal
- web_gui build is broken HOT 5
- frontend_example with PyInstaller HOT 3
- Running a phase in backgroud HOT 7
- Request: Add ability to FAIL_AND_CONTINUE instead of STOP when a Phase reaches max_repeats
- How to build a test running multiple test groups concurrently, but showing I/O data of all test groups on the same webpage? HOT 1
- HIL testing? HOT 5
- multiple monitors for a single phase?
- KeyError in `PlugManager.provide_plugs` HOT 6
- monitors decorator does not fully copy the specification of the monitored phase
- Feature Request(?): Provide a mechanism for displaying images in the front-end HOT 1
- Progress bar/completion status stops if test is marked as FAIL. HOT 4
- How could I call a PhaseDescriptor explicitly? HOT 3
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from openhtf.